Output d9898cb2b1095de6a4d145493ebb1da26b3523e002b1f49db7f71ff6855cc08e:0

value
990264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95da1510351f1f02819246bc6a8b8c62dced33d5 OP_EQUAL
address
3FMMrkPN4n9kGk9ufk95EiBhS48QfBjP1c
transaction
d9898cb2b1095de6a4d145493ebb1da26b3523e002b1f49db7f71ff6855cc08e
spent
true